教师工资管理系统期末实习优秀作品

需积分: 5 4 下载量 83 浏览量 更新于2024-10-20 3 收藏 1.82MB RAR 举报
资源摘要信息:"教师工资管理系统" 1. 系统开发背景: 在教育行业中,管理教师工资是行政工作中的重要一环。教师工资管理系统的设计与实现,旨在提供一个方便、快捷的平台,以便高效准确地处理教师的工资数据,确保工资发放的透明度和准确性。此外,该系统也有助于学校管理者进行财务规划和预算编制。 2. 系统功能: - 基本信息管理:录入和修改教师的个人信息、教学科目、教学时数等基础数据。 - 工资计算:根据教师的工作量(课时、加班等)、岗位级别、教学成果等因素,自动计算每位教师的应发工资。 - 考勤管理:记录教师的出勤情况,包括迟到、早退、请假、缺勤等,并在工资计算中予以体现。 - 福利管理:管理教师的各类福利发放情况,如保险、公积金、各类补贴等。 - 报表统计:生成各类工资报表,包括个人工资明细、部门工资汇总、历史工资对比等,便于查询和存档。 - 权限管理:不同的系统管理员和财务人员根据工作需要设置不同的操作权限。 3. 系统技术特点: - 用户友好:系统界面设计直观简洁,方便用户操作。 - 安全性:系统应具备完善的权限控制机制,确保数据的安全性和保密性。 - 稳定性:系统应当具备良好的稳定性,能够处理大量数据,且不易出现故障。 - 可扩展性:系统设计时应考虑到未来可能的扩展需求,便于后续升级和功能增加。 4. 开发工具与语言: - 开发工具:为了制作该系统,开发者可能使用了如Visual Studio、Eclipse等集成开发环境(IDE),以及数据库管理工具如MySQL Workbench或SQL Server Management Studio。 - 编程语言:常见的选择包括Java、C#、Python等,这些语言各自有不同的适用场景和优缺点。 - 数据库:大多数管理系统会使用关系型数据库,如MySQL、Oracle、SQL Server等,来存储教师工资相关的数据。 5. 系统实施过程: - 需求分析:与学校管理层、教师、财务部门沟通,收集对工资管理系统的需求。 - 系统设计:根据需求分析结果,设计系统架构、数据库结构、界面布局等。 - 编码实现:根据设计文档进行编码,逐步构建系统的各个模块。 - 测试:进行单元测试、集成测试、系统测试和用户验收测试,确保系统的稳定性和可靠性。 - 部署上线:完成测试后,将系统部署到实际的服务器上,供用户使用。 - 维护与升级:根据用户反馈进行系统维护,对出现的问题及时修正,并根据业务发展需要进行功能升级。 6. 期末实习与项目评价: 实习生在期末制作教师工资管理系统,可能是其课程学习的一个实践环节,也是检验学生理论与实践结合能力的重要方式。系统虽然制作简陋,但能够完成基本的工资管理任务,并且还能获得优秀的评价,说明系统在基本功能的实现上是成功的,同时,系统的可用性和稳定性也得到了认可。 7. 教师工资管理系统的意义: - 提高工作效率:通过自动化计算工资,减少人工计算的时间和错误率。 - 数据分析:为管理层提供详尽的数据分析支持,便于做出更科学的管理决策。 - 资源优化:合理分配教育资源,确保教师的薪资待遇和福利待遇公平公正。 - 透明度:提高工资发放的透明度,增强教师对工资管理的信任感。 8. 对未来的影响: 随着信息技术的不断进步,教师工资管理系统将会更加智能化、自动化,集成更多的人工智能技术,如大数据分析、机器学习等,用于更加精准地预测和规划教师薪酬体系。此外,随着教育信息化的发展,该系统还可能与校园其他信息系统(如教务系统、人事系统)进行集成,形成更为全面的校园信息化管理平台。